Understanding Gran Canaria's March Climate
March in Gran Canaria marks the transition from winter to spring, offering a delightful climate perfect for outdoor activities. While the weather is generally mild and sunny, don't forget to remember that it's not entirely predictable. The island benefits from its subtropical climate, moderated by the trade winds and its proximity to the African coast. This results in consistent, comfortable temperatures throughout the year, but March offers a particularly sweet spot Which is the point..

Average Temperatures: You can expect average daily high temperatures to hover around 20-22°C (68-72°F) during March. Nighttime temperatures are generally pleasant, usually staying between 14-16°C (57-61°F). This makes for comfortable days filled with sunshine and cool evenings perfect for a relaxed dinner. That said, these are averages, and daily fluctuations are possible Still holds up..
Regional Variations in Temperature
While Gran Canaria enjoys a relatively uniform climate, subtle temperature variations exist across its diverse landscapes. The island's geography has a big impact:
-
Coastal Areas: Coastal regions, such as Las Palmas, Maspalomas, and Playa del Inglés, typically experience slightly warmer temperatures, especially during the day, due to the moderating influence of the ocean. Sea breezes can also offer a refreshing respite from the sun's heat.
-
Mountainous Regions: Inland areas and higher altitudes, including the central mountainous regions like Tejeda and Roque Nublo, experience cooler temperatures, particularly at night. While daytime temperatures are still pleasant, you can expect a noticeable drop in temperature as you ascend. These areas can be slightly windier as well.
-
Southern Resorts: The southern resorts tend to enjoy more sunshine and slightly warmer temperatures than the north. This makes them particularly popular during March.
Understanding these variations is key to choosing the right location for your trip, based on your personal preferences.
Sunshine Hours and Rainfall
March in Gran Canaria boasts a significant number of sunshine hours, usually exceeding 7 hours per day. The chances of experiencing prolonged periods of rain are relatively low, however, it's wise to pack a light jacket or umbrella just in case. Rainfall in March is generally low, with occasional showers being possible, mostly short-lived. This provides ample opportunity for soaking up the sun and enjoying outdoor pursuits. The weather patterns are influenced by the trade winds, which can bring intermittent cloud cover, but these tend to dissipate quickly.

Sea Temperature in March
While air temperatures are pleasant, it’s important to note the sea temperature. The Atlantic Ocean surrounding Gran Canaria is usually around 18-20°C (64-68°F) in March. This is pleasant for some swimmers, but others might find it a bit chilly. In real terms, consider this when planning your beach activities. Wetsuits might be useful for watersports enthusiasts in the ocean Simple, but easy to overlook..
